Rialto Statistics Back to top
  • Population (2000): 91,873
  • Land Area (2000): 56.645 square kilometers
  • Water Area (2000): 0.023 square kilometers
  • Average Daily / Average High Temperature In Fahrenheit (Celsius) In January (1961-1990): 53.6186 (12.0) / (-17.8)
  • Average Daily / Average High Temperature In Fahrenheit (Celsius) In July (1961-1990): 79.4186 (26.3) / 97.0186 (36.1)
  • Average Annual Heating Degree Days (1961-1990): 1,719
  • Average Annual Cooling Degree Days (1961-1990): 1,804
  • Average Annual Precipitation (1961-1990): 15 inches
